If you're planning to visit Italy's churches or other religious sites, it's important to dress modestly. In this case, you can still wear linen pants, but choose a blouse with a higher neckline and longer sleeves. Opt for neutral colors like beige or light gray, and avoid loud or flashy accessories. Remember to bring a lightweight cardigan or scarf to cover your shoulders if needed.

Frequently asked questions
- In April, the weather in Italy can be quite unpredictable. It's best to pack layers, including lightweight sweaters, long-sleeved shirts, and a light jacket or raincoat. You may also want to bring a mix of pants and shorts, as well as comfortable walking shoes.
- While April can generally be mild in Italy, especially in the southern regions, there can still be cooler evenings and occasional rain showers. It's a good idea to pack a few warmer items such as a light sweater or cardigan, or a scarf to layer over your outfits.
- While sandals or flip-flops may be comfortable for warmer days, it's best to also pack a pair of closed-toe shoes for exploring cities and historical sites. Some places may have cobblestone streets or require more formal footwear, so having a versatile pair of shoes is recommended.
- While Italy generally has a relaxed dress code, it's important to dress appropriately when visiting churches or religious sites. Both men and women should make sure their shoulders and knees are covered, so packing a light shawl or a pair of pants may be useful. Additionally, some upscale restaurants or evening events may have a more formal dress code, so being prepared with a dressier outfit is always a good idea.
